微软的virtual studio编辑器那是宇宙第一大编辑器,可惜就是太笨重,遇到性能差一些的电脑设备,简直无法快速的编辑项目。
而vs code编辑器轻便易用,想要编辑哪种项目,只需扩展插件就OK,针对性能差一些的电脑设备也可以安装。
一、下载vscode
vscode的下载地址:https://code.visualstudio.com/download
二、安装.net core sdk
.net core sdk下载地址:https://dotnet.microsoft.com/learn/dotnet/hello-world-tutorial#install
三、汉化vscode
如果用英文版的不习惯,则可以引入汉化包。
打开vscode编辑器,使用组合键ctrl+shift+x打开扩展组件,搜索“Chinese (Simplified) Language Pack for Visual Studio Code“,然后点击install安装。安装完毕后,重启vscode编辑器即可。或者使用trl+shift+p打开语言显示配置,选择中文。
四、创建项目
1、在vscode编辑器中打开一个文件夹,这个文件夹就是当前项目的工作目录。
2、创建一个空的sln解决方案
使用组合键ctrl+shift+'新建一个终端, 新建解决方案:
dotnet new sln -n myPro
3、创建一个控制台项目
dotnet new console -n myPro.App
4.将控制台项目加入到解决方案中
dotnet sln add myPro.App
5.myPro.App引用其他lib项目
dotnet new classlib -n Infrastructure
使用如下命令让myPro.App引用Infrastructure项目:
dotnet add myPro.App reference/package Infrastructure
【注意】如果是引用项目,则使用关键字reference;如果是引用包,则使用package。
五、编译和运行
输入dotnet run -p myPro.App或者按下F5键,编辑器需要我们选择debug的环境,选择.NET Core即可
接下来会出现一个有关launch.json的界面,launch.json是一个vscode启动程序的配置文件。一般如果调式不了,就需要看看program和cwd节点是否配置正确。如下图所示:
{
// 使用 IntelliSense 了解相关属性。
// 悬停以查看现有属性的描述。
// 欲了解更多信息,请访问: https://go.microsoft.com/fwlink/?linkid=830387
"version": "0.2.0",
"configurations": [
{
"name": ".NET Core Launch (console)",
"type": "coreclr",
"request": "launch",
"preLaunchTask": "build",
"program": "${workspaceFolder}/bin/Debug/<target-framework>/<project-name.dll>",
"args": [],
"cwd": "${workspaceFolder}",
"stopAtEntry": false,
"console": "internalConsole"
}
]
}
六、扩展Nuget包
1、安装nuget包管理器
需要在扩展组件中,搜索NuGet Package Manager,安装nuget包管理器。
2、使用nuget包管理器
按下ctrl+shift+p,在弹出的命令框内输入 nuget package manager:add package:
本文系转载,前往查看
如有侵权,请联系 cloudcommunity@tencent.com 删除。
本文系转载,前往查看
如有侵权,请联系 cloudcommunity@tencent.com 删除。